Speaker has a whining noise

I mustve done something to make the rear speaker mess up cause it made a 'popping' noise. Now when I turn on the stereo there Is axlopping noise and the speaker whistles with the revs of the car.
Anyone know how to go about fixing this? It's driving me crazy..

The stereo is all oem if that matters

You have a ground issue...You want to check all your connections. If everything is good, I believe they make noise filters. Haven't used them in years though....
